WebSome verbs are used with to, and some other verbs are used with for before the indirect object. To + indirect object. Some common verbs that are used with to + indirect object are: give, lend, offer, pass, promise, read, sell, send, show, tell, write. You should give an apology to Tom. She showed the letter to all her friends. For + indirect ... Web20 mrt. 2024 · The indirect object of a sentence is the recipient of the direct object.
